Angel Acosta walks us through the “cultural dexterity” required to navigate the many worlds he lives and works in as a doctoral student, education consultant, international speaker, and first generation immigrant. He entered his graduate program as a nontraditional student who simultaneously worked in a college access nonprofit, and unlike his doctoral program peers, he was not an educator by training.  Angel says, “When I coached with you, I was hungry for clarity. I wanted to curate a profile, a resumé, and way of thinking about all the work I was doing and texts I was reading in a way that didn’t feel scattered. I wanted to be more intentional and understand what this doctorate meant about who I was becoming and what I could do professionally.” (28:31) Angel is a true intellectual who reflects deeply on his lived experience in the context of social structures, but he doesn’t stop there.
